Michael Bisping Wants To Face “Top Fighter” at UFC 105, Planning on Rematch with Henderson

Posted by Kris Karkoski on Jul 20, 2009 at 4:36 pm ET68 Comments

Michael BispingMichael Bisping will look to rebound from his UFC 100 knockout loss to Dan Henderson when he returns to action at UFC 105 on November 14 at the MEN Arena in Manchester, England.

“I am gonna kick someone’s backside in Manchester in front of my hometown crowd, then fight again as soon as possible and then rematch with Henderson,” Bisping told the Manchester Evening News. “That wasn’t the best of me in the ring in Vegas and I want another crack at him. I want a top fighter in Manchester, I want to get back up there straight away. That’s what I have told the UFC. I can’t wait to fight in Manchester again, it will be good to fight in front of my own supporters again.”

Welterweight James Wilks and lightweight Ross Pearson, British fighters who won their respective weight classes on The Ultimate Fighter 9 under the coaching of Bisping, are also expected to compete on the card.

No opponents are yet rumored for any of the fighters.
